What if understanding the nuances between different types of diabetes could revolutionize your approach to prevention and management? Join us as we unravel the latest changes in diabetic guidelines with the esteemed Dr. Arpeta Gupta, a leading endocrinologist. Dr. Gupta expertly demystifies the distinctions between type 1, type 2, and the emerging concept of type 3 diabetes. Learn how type 1 diabetes, often seen in children, is marked by pancreatic damage leading to insulin dependence, while type 2 diabetes involves insulin resistance primarily in the liver. Discover the complexities of type 3 diabetes, which arises from extended type 2 diabetes or other conditions like chemotherapy and viral infections, resulting in an autoimmune response predominantly in older adults. This essential discussion highlights the importance of accurately classifying diabetes for effective prevention and management strategies.
In the second segment, released on August 28, 2024, we delve into the powerful synergy between internal medicine subspecialties and how their integration significantly enhances patient care. We highlight the importance of protecting various organ systems and explore the dynamic collaboration among medical professionals. We also spotlight the pivotal role of clinical trials, focusing on the development journey of Semaglutide, widely known as Ozempic. Dr. Gupta shares invaluable insights on its history and advancement, emphasizing the impact of clinical research in pioneering new treatments.
